Myristica fragrans (Nutmeg Tree) Seeds

Myristica fragrans, commonly known as Nutmeg Tree, is an evergreen tree from the Myristicaceae family. Native to the Spice Islands of Indonesia, this tree is the source of two highly prized spices: nutmeg, derived from its seeds, and mace, derived from the seed’s aril. Renowned for its culinary, medicinal, and aromatic properties, Nutmeg is a globally important spice crop.

Characteristics:

• Plant Description: The Nutmeg Tree grows to a height of 10–20 meters with a straight trunk and dense, spreading canopy. It has dark green, lance-shaped leaves and produces small, yellowish-white flowers. The tree bears oval, yellow fruits that split open when mature, revealing a seed surrounded by a bright red aril (mace).
• Dual Spices: The seeds are processed into nutmeg, while the red aril surrounding the seeds is dried to produce mace.
• Climate Adaptability: Thrives in tropical climates with high humidity and well-drained soils.

Uses and Benefits:

• Culinary Applications: Nutmeg and mace are used as spices in sweet and savory dishes, baked goods, beverages, and spice blends worldwide.
• Medicinal Properties: Nutmeg has carminative, anti-inflammatory, and antioxidant properties. It is traditionally used to aid digestion, relieve pain, and improve sleep.
• Aromatic Uses: Nutmeg oil, extracted from the seeds, is used in perfumes, cosmetics, and as a flavoring agent.
• Cultural and Economic Significance: Nutmeg has been a valuable trade commodity for centuries, driving exploration and commerce in the spice trade.

Cultivation:

• Sowing: Plant fresh seeds immediately after harvesting, as they lose viability quickly. Sow in a nursery bed with well-drained, fertile soil. Cover lightly with soil and keep consistently moist. Germination occurs within 6–8 weeks.
• Growth Conditions: Prefers partial shade during the seedling stage and full sun as it matures. The tree thrives in loamy, rich soils with a pH of 5.5–7.5 and requires consistent watering.
• Maintenance: A slow-growing tree, it requires regular mulching and fertilization for optimal growth. Prune to maintain shape and remove dead branches.
